[QUOTE="bobongo, post: 855784, member: 3893"] I hope we're going after this guy: [URL unfurl="true"]https://portal.rivals.com/news/transfer-tracker-ivy-league-ol-piling-up-the-offers[/URL] [B]At Cornell: [/B]Nourzad started the final 20 games of his Cornell career, having played both right tackle and left tackle. He was a Second-Team All-Ivy League selection as a sophomore in 2019, did not play in 2020 due to the Covid-19 pandemic and was First-Team All-Ivy League this fall. He will have two years of eligibility remaining after he graduates from Cornell in May with a degree in [B]mechanical engineering[/B]. The [B]Georgia native[/B] can play on the left or ride side or at guard and he's nasty on film so it's no surprise to see so many schools interested. [/QUOTE]
